You don't choose a target for Etched Slith's last ability at the time it triggers. Rather, a second "reflexive" ability triggers when you put a +1/+1 counter on Etched Slith this way. You choose a target for that ability as it goes on the stack. Each player may respond to this triggered ability as normal.

If there's more than one type of counter on the targeted permanent or opponent, Etched Slith's controller chooses which counter to remove.
In a case where you put more than one +1/+1 counter on Etched Slith with its last ability (for example, because of the effect of Doubling Season), the reflexive ability will trigger once for each +1/+1 counter you put on it this way.

Card #91 of *Modern Horizons 3*, the set that shipped alongside the June 2024 Modern Horizons 3 release.
Card type: Artifact Creature — Phyrexian Slith, color identity black, printed at uncommon. Uncommons fill the middle-tier slots in a standard booster configuration. Mana cost: {1}{B} (2 converted). Keyword abilities: Menace.
Legal across the major constructed formats — Modern, Legacy, Vintage, and Commander — plus Standard rotation play.
